ECHO_U -Emergency towing If towing is necessary, we recommend you to have it done by your Toyota dealer or a commercial tow truck service. CAUTION D Use extreme caution when towing vehicles. Avoid sudden starts or erratic driving maneuvers which would place excessive stress on the emergency towing eyelets and towing cable or chain. The eyelets and towing cable or chain may break and cause serious injury or damage. SU41023 If a towing service is not available in an emergency, your vehicle may be temporarily towed by a cable or chain secured to either the emergency towing eyelet∗1 on the front of the vehicle or to the left emergency towing eyelet under the rear of the vehicle. Use extreme caution when towing vehicles. A driver must be in the vehicle to steer it and operate the brakes. Towing in this manner may be done only on hard- surfaced roads for a short distance and at low speeds. Also, the wheels, axles, drive train, steering and brakes must all be in good condition. ∗ 1 Front eyelet D In case of installing the front eyelet on the vehicle, be sure to tighten in the front eyelet securely. If the tightening is loose, it may come off when towing and result in death or serious injury to the passenger in the ront vehicle or damage to that vehicle. Front SU41024 The front eyelet is stored in the trunk with the jack handle. To install: Remove the cover of front eyelet and install it as shown in the illustration. NOTICE z Use only a cable or chain specifically intended for use in towing vehicles. Securely fasten the cable or chain to the towing eyelet provided. z Do not use the left rear eyelet.
